Service Manual NeoTherm 80 - NeoTherm 285
Combustion Adjustment Procedure -
Units with Original (White) User Interface
WARNING
Improper adjustment may lead to poor combustion quality, increasing
the amount of carbon monoxide produced. Excessive carbon monox-
ide levels may lead to personal injury or death.
Equipment required:
Combustion analyzer
2 mm Allen wrench
Procedure:
1. Measure the CO
2
and O
2
in the ue products at High
Fire. The NeoTherm must be forced go to High Fire
to obtain accurate results.
How to get there: From the “Home” screen, press
and hold the Next button for 3 seconds to go to Di-
agnostic mode. Press the Next button several times
until you see “Rate” and “100%.” The NT unit is now
forced into high re mode for 5 minutes.
The CO
2
readings should be between the values
shown in Table C2-1. If the CO
2
is not within the
range shown, adjustments may be made. To adjust
the high re CO
2
, locate the high re adjuster screw
as shown in Fig. C2-1. Slowly make adjustments in
1/16 of a revolution increments until the CO
2
is within
the range identied. For the high re adjustment,
turning the screw counter-clockwise (CCW) opens
the adjustment and makes the mixture richer.
